Suggest a better descriptionIn a large saucepan, heat oil over medium heat; cook garlic, onion and celery for about 5 minutes or until tender. Add tomato juice, chicken stock and vinegar. Bring to boil; reduce heat and simmer gently for 10 minutes. Stir in tomatoes and zucchini; simmer for 5 minutes. Add basil, parsley, oregano and pepper; simmer for 2 minutes.
